Output 66d0da261d28d4eb9750b7bb3c4c1c7d427574a71d1c438508832e2763ef3a31:0

value
1265961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aa00193aca97317dd4d816964838ed3247b0958 OP_EQUAL
address
39xCRENYxMSqzb2kVNceRoz9QTg5rhsD2k
transaction
66d0da261d28d4eb9750b7bb3c4c1c7d427574a71d1c438508832e2763ef3a31
spent
true